Lockheed Martin Space is seeking a Program Management Manager to join the Next Generation Interceptor (NGI) program and lead the Dynamic Ballast System (DBS) mechanism development and production.
LocationSelected candidates must be located near our Lockheed Martin Space facilities in Sunnyvale, CA, or Littleton, CO. The role requires onsite presence in the office as needed.
What does this role look like?Join us where you will lead a team of engineers developing missile avionics for use across Lockheed Martin Space. In this role, you are responsible for managing an interdisciplinary engineering team in design, assembly, test, and integration of avionics hardware.
Key Responsibilities- Lead the development of a new defense system.
- Direct the team through development and production of the DBS mechanism.
- Lead cost, schedule, and technical effort related to scope, cost estimation, planning, scheduling, staffing, and tracking.
- Prepare for and participate in Manufacturing Readiness Review (MRR), Test Readiness Review (TRR), qualification testing, and production.
- Oversee selection, hiring, and management of staff.
